Cadiz, Spania: fish market/piata de pesteCadiz, Spania: fish market/piata de pesteCadiz, Spania: fish market/piata de pesteDelicioasa2018-01-06T22:52:46+02:00Cadiz, Spania: fish market/piata de pesteDelicioasa2018-01-06T22:52:46+02:00